使用 OpenLiteSpeed 优化 wordpress 网站速度 2024.11 月记录

事前记录

作者本身不是技术出身,所以文章可能出现技术错误。仅以小白视角来记录,适合小白观看!

网站使用的是 wordpress+子比主题,wordpress 本身的速度就不快,更何况加上 子比 这个重量级主题。而且还使用的 阿里云 99 包年的 2H2G 的服务器。

其实还是不太好搞的,说是 优化网站速度 ,其实还要考虑到网站的访问人数问题。不能仅仅是网站速度够快,而且要承受更多的人同时访问。

选择 OpenLiteSpeed

OpenLiteSpeed 并没有 Apache 和 Nginx 使用的那么广泛,也没有那么有名。但是不可否认 OpenLiteSpeed 确实在处理 PHP 方面比 Nginx 优秀很多,但相同的 OpenLiteSpeed 也不像 Nginx 兼容性好,国内现在比较知名的运维面板 宝塔面板1panel 面板 对 OpenLiteSpeed 的支持也不太好。

OpenLiteSpeed 现在仅支持 Centos(6-8),debian(7-11) 和 Ubuntu(14,16,18,20) 等 liunx 系统,所以如果 你的系统不在这其中,而且不能更换的话,建议 放弃使用 OpenLiteSpeed 。

你可以在这篇文章 https://vps.group/ols-ls-cache-vs-nginx-wp-super-cache-benchmark-20171015.html 看到 OpenLiteSpeed 和 LNMP 的测试对比。

我直接在这里说一下结果,同样的服务器,OpenLiteSpeed + 插件 比 Nginx +插件 消耗的时间更少,而且错误数为

image

开始安装使用

OpenLiteSpeed 本身是有一个专门适配的面板 CyberPanel 。但是由于我不适应 CyberPanel 面板的操作,所以我还是选择了 宝塔面板 。

安装宝塔面板的过程就不多说了,有一个注意事项,如果你想在线安装宝塔面板,建议只选择安装面板。

image

安装完宝塔面板之后,按照一下步骤进行。

  1. 进入宝塔面板:不要选择推荐的环境。
  2. 进入软件商城,安装 mysql 、 php 、 OpenLiteSpeed 。仅安装这三个就可以完美运行 wordpress,你可以根据自己的需要安装其他程序。 (ps:如果在安装过程中出现问题,请先卸载已经安装的,再按照 mysql>openlitespeed>php 的顺序安装。)

    image

  3. 安装完成后,进入网站,点击添加站点,一键部署 wordpress 。
  4. image

    部署完成后就可以进入域名,安装 wordpress 程序了。 (ps: 安装的 wordpress 不需要设置 伪静态!)

  5. 进入网站后台,选择 插件--安装新插件--搜索 LiteSpeed 。安装,启用就可以了。image

注意,使用 LiteSpeed 插件后,插件会缓存你现在的 CSS,JS 等文件。所以如果你修改内容后,要看到效果,需要清除缓存。例如:你需要验证百度站长,谷歌站长等平台。

image

 

额外的优化措施

安装 redis

1 、查看已安装的软件,点击 php 的设置

image

2 、选择安装 redis 扩展 (安装之后,要重启一下 PHP)

image

3 、进入网站后台,安装新插件。搜索 Redis Object Cache,然后安装,启用就可以了

image

文章暂时不能评论,有问题可以到讨论区发帖
© 版权声明
THE END
喜欢就支持一下吧